Paediatric Exercise Physiology is all about helping children thrive through movement. It uses fun, purposeful, and goal-based exercise to support a child’s physical health, development, and emotional wellbeing.

Our sessions are delivered by Accredited Exercise Physiologists (AEPs) — university-trained professionals who understand how the body moves and grows. They’re experts in designing individualised programs for children of all ages and abilities, including those with:

  • Developmental delays

  • Physical or intellectual disabilities

  • Chronic health conditions

  • Mental health challenges

  • Coordination or motor skill difficulties

Through tailored movement-based therapy, children can improve their strength, coordination, balance, confidence, and ability to participate in everyday activities — whether it’s playing with friends, keeping up in the classroom, or joining in at sport.
